A leading manufacturing company in East Lindsey is seeking a Maintenance Manager to transform asset performance and drive operational success. The role involves leading asset management strategies and managing large-scale projects.

Candidates must have:

  • Over 7 years of engineering management experience
  • Strong knowledge of mechanical and electrical systems
  • Excellent analytical skills

This permanent position offers competitive salary and benefits including pension contributions, life assurance, and development opportunities.
